WARRANTY
Use only MASTERFLEX precision tubing with MASTERFLEX pumps to ensure
optimum performance. Use of other tubing may void applicable warranties.
The Manufacturer warrants this product to be free from significant deviations
from published specifications. If repair or adjustment is necessary within the
warranty period, the problem will be corrected at no charge if it is not due to
misuse or abuse on your part, as determined by the Manufacturer. Repair costs
outside the warranty period, or those resulting from product misuse or abuse,
may be invoiced to you.
The warranty period for this product is two (2) years from date of purchase.
PRODUCT RETURN
To limit charges and delays, contact the seller or Manufacturer for authorization
and shipping instructions before returning the product, either within or outside
of the warranty period. When returning the product, please state the reason for
the return. For your protection, pack the product carefully and insure it against
possible damage or loss. Any damages resulting from improper packaging are
your responsibility.

Overview

The MASTERFLEX L/S EASY-LOAD® II Pump Head is a peristaltic pump system designed for simple, easy-to-use fluid transfer. It is compatible with MASTERFLEX L/S drives or other compatible systems that feature a standard tang interface. The pump head accommodates various tubing sizes, allowing for a wide range of flow rates. Its unique over-center cam design and automatic tubing retention facilitate quick tubing changes and reduce maintenance time.

Function Description:

The pump head operates by compressing and releasing tubing as rollers rotate, creating a peristaltic action that propels fluid. This design ensures that the fluid only contacts the inside of the tubing, preventing contamination of the pump head and simplifying cleaning. The EASY-LOAD II design allows for quick and easy tubing installation and removal. For multi-channel applications, up to four pump heads can be mounted in tandem, depending on the torque capabilities of the drive.

Important Technical Specifications:

  • Number of rollers: 4
  • Maximum pump speed: 600 rpm
  • Nominal torque load (Running): Up to 90 oz-in (6.5 kg·cm)
  • Housing materials: Polyphenylene sulfide (PPS), acetal, nylon
  • Roller materials: Cold-Rolled Steel (CRS) / Stainless Steel (SS)
  • Bearing materials: Cold-Rolled Steel (CRS) / Sealed Stainless Steel
  • Rotor materials: Stainless Steel (SS)
  • Operating Temperature: 32°F to 104°F (0°C to 40°C)
  • Storage Temperature: -49°F to 149°F (-45°C to 65°C)
  • Humidity: 0% to 90% (non-condensing)
  • Dimensions (W x H x D):
    • Operating: 4 in x 4-3/4 in x 2-3/4 in (102 mm x 121 mm x 70 mm)
    • Open: 4 in x 5-1/2 in x 2-3/4 in (102 mm x 140 mm x 70 mm)
  • Weight: 1.4 lb (0.6 kg)
  • Noise level: <70 dBA @ 1 meter
  • Compliance: EN809 (EU Machinery Directive)

Flow Rate and Pressure/Vacuum Data (Typical, tested with NORPRENE®, PHARMED® BPT, and TYGON® tubing):

  • L/S® 13: 0.06 mL/Rev, 36 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 40 psig (2.7 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 14: 0.22 mL/Rev, 130 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 40 psig (2.7 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 16: 0.80 mL/Rev, 480 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 40 psig (2.7 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 25: 1.7 mL/Rev, 1000 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 35 psig (2.4 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 17: 2.8 mL/Rev, 1700 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 20 psig (1.4 bar) max discharge pressure, 20 in (510 mm) Hg vacuum, 22 ft (6.7 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 18: 3.8 mL/Rev, 2300 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 5 psig (1.0 bar) max discharge pressure, 20 in (510 mm) Hg vacuum, 22 ft (6.7 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 15: 1.7 mL/Rev, 1000 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 40 psig (2.7 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 24: 2.8 mL/Rev, 1700 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 40 psig (2.7 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 35: 3.8 mL/Rev, 2300 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 35 psig (2.4 bar) max discharge pressure, 26 in (660 mm) Hg vacuum, 29 ft (8.8 m) H₂O suction lift.
  • L/S® 36: 4.8 mL/Rev, 2900 mL/min @ 600 rpm, 20 psig (1.4 bar) max discharge pressure, 24 in (610 mm) Hg vacuum, 27 ft (8.3 m) H₂O suction lift.

Usage Features:

  • Tubing Compatibility: Designed for use with MASTERFLEX precision tubing to ensure optimum performance. Use of other tubing may void warranties.
  • Easy-Load Mechanism: The pump head features a loading lever that, when rotated to the left, opens the pump for easy tubing installation. Rotating the lever to the right closes the pump, securing the tubing.
  • Multi-channel Mounting: L/S EASY-LOAD II Pump Heads can be mounted in tandem (up to four) using special mounting hardware (sold separately). The tubing on the inside pump head(s) can be changed.
  • Occlusion Adjustment (on 77201-60, -62 models only): An occlusion adjustment knob allows users to fine-tune performance. Settings include "4" for nominal performance, "5" for increased pressure/vacuum with reduced tubing life, and "2" or "3" for longer tubing life with less pressure and vacuum. It is recommended to turn the knob to "1" after loading and adjust until the pump primes. Occlusion usually does not need to be readjusted when changing tubing.
  • Safety Precautions:
    • This product is not intended for patient-connected applications, including medical and dental use, and has not been submitted for FDA approval.
    • Always turn the drive off before removing or installing tubing to prevent fingers or loose clothing from being caught in the rollers.
    • Stop the drive when changing tubing or its position in the rotor mechanism (the rotor is partially exposed when the loading lever is open).
    • Do not over-tighten screws or wing nuts during multi-channel mounting.
    • Ensure tubes do not cross inside the pump head.

Maintenance Features:

  • No Lubrication Required: The L/S EASY-LOAD II Pump Head does not require lubrication.
  • Cleaning: The pump head can be cleaned with a mild detergent solution. It should not be immersed, and excessive fluid should not be used.
  • Rotor Replacement: The rotor assembly is replaceable. To disassemble the pump head for cleaning or rotor replacement:
    1. Remove the pump head from the drive.
    2. Remove the rear cover of the pump head.
    3. Remove the two screws securing the rotor.
    4. Remove the old rotor assembly.
    5. Install the new rotor assembly and secure it with two screws.
    6. Reinstall the rear cover.
